Primary school enrollment in Guyana in 2012 — 93.1%. Ranked 72 in the world out of 142. Since 1971, the indicator has risen by 6.2 pp.

About the indicator

The net primary enrollment rate — the share of children of official school age enrolled in primary school out of all children of that age. Unlike the gross ratio it cannot exceed 100%, because it leaves out pupils older or younger than the official age.
